Fund Accountant (Elite Hedge Fund) - 26148 Fund Accountant - Boston MA - Hedge Fund Our team is working with a leading hedge fund based in Boston looking to hire a Fund Accountant to their growing team. Ideally, the client would look for candidates coming out of another Hedge Fund or experience with closed-end fund reporting, as well as experience within Big 4. Responsibilities: Maintain internal accounting records in accordance with US GAAP. Coordinate with fund administrators to ensure timely and accurate record keeping and reconciliations. Assist in quarterly fund admin reporting review. Prepare performance reporting packages (IRR, TVPI, MOIC, etc.). Prepare internal shadow workbook, including NAV & management fee calculations. Coordinate the collection of quarterly financials/KPIs and maintain private investment portfolio company data. Assist in year-end audits and tax filings. Assist with various financial reporting efforts, including quarterly investor letters, portfolio attribution, tax analysis, financial statements, marketing workbooks, and other performance reports. Assist in responding to investor requests and be responsible for reviewing audit confirmations responses from fund admin. Coordinate and initial review of investor reporting, including capital call notices, distribution notices, partnership capital account statements, and other ad hoc requests. Support finance team with other requests from various groups, including Investor Relations and Compliance. Ensure accurate and seamless distribution of financial data for the portfolio and funds. Requirements: 3-5 years of experience, preferably with a CPA. Fund accounting experience, preferably with close-end funds; hedge fund experience is a plus. Direct experience with tax and audit, large accounting firm experience preferred.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Excel. Experience with Ipreo and Tradar a plus. This role is a full-time hybrid (3 days in, 2 at home) opportunity that will offer up to $130K base salary, up to 30% bonus, & great benefits.
